Transaction 1375853aa711dbc541b1e77d49271f8749661f061492073ea8924c514a82e798
2 Input
2 Outputs
- 1375853aa711dbc541b1e77d49271f8749661f061492073ea8924c514a82e798:0
- 1375853aa711dbc541b1e77d49271f8749661f061492073ea8924c514a82e798:1
value 736973
address 1DFfstjNuDsEQqkLJPfvXLFXHoXAirHBR9
value 1973052
address 12qgdi3KpPGD2UEqJ2aLhFEZFdkUGWLYbP